The Harlem Renaissance is noteworthy because
antoniya [11.8K]

<em><u>Answer:</u></em>

D. It was the first significant artistic movement springing from Black culture.

<em><u>Explanation:</u></em>

The Harlem Renaissance was the advancement of the Harlem neighborhood in New York City as a black social mecca in the mid twentieth Century and the consequent social and aesthetic blast that came about.

This movement lasted from the 1910s through the mid-1930s, the period is viewed as a brilliant age in African American culture, showing in writing, music, art and stage performance.

Judicial review is a very important principal in our divided government. What were John Marshall’s three principles of judicial
Nadusha1986 [10]

Answer:

The three principles of judicial review are as follows:

The Constitution is the supreme law of the country.

The Supreme Court has the ultimate authority in ruling on constitutional matters.

The judiciary must rule against any law that conflicts with the Constitution.

Marshall was a rancher in New Mexico. His dog ran off and he had to chase her past the boundaries of his ranch. When he finally
Anettt [7]

Keeping in mind the description of the stone point given in the story, we can state Marshall the rancher was looking at a Folsom point.

As it's known, a Folsom is a kind of stone point with a leaf-like shape which has a concave base and wide, shallow grooves/flutes running almost the entire length of the point.
